Harley Davidson FLTC 1340 Tour Glide Classic (1986)
The Harley-Davidson FLTC 1340 Tour Glide Classic defies convention with its unapologetic approach to heavyweight touring.
With a potent 1338cc vee-twin engine, the FLTC unleashes a distinctive song that’s unmistakably American. This liquid-cooled powerplant is a departure from the multi-cylinder engines and overhead camshafts found in other high-end tourers. Instead, Harley-Davidson’s engineers have crafted an engine with its own unique character, one that rewards riders who appreciate the nuances of a well-tuned vee-twin.
The Tour Glide Classic’s running gear is equally unconventional, featuring Gates Poly Chain belt drive and whitewall tires that evoke a bygone era. The heel-and-toe shifter and brake pedal are distinctive touches that set this bike apart from its competitors. Despite initial reservations about the belt drive system, our testing has shown it to be lighter, cleaner, and easier to maintain than traditional chain drives.
As we rode the FLTC through rolling hills and twisty roads, its reduced vibration became increasingly apparent. This, combined with its impressive 26-pound weight loss over previous models, made for a truly engaging riding experience.
